Debian如何自定义PostgreSQL参数
导读:在Debian系统上自定义PostgreSQL参数,可以通过修改postgresql.conf文件来实现。以下是详细步骤: 1. 登录到PostgreSQL服务器 首先,确保你有权限登录到PostgreSQL服务器。你可以使用psql命令行...
在Debian系统上自定义PostgreSQL参数,可以通过修改postgresql.conf
文件来实现。以下是详细步骤:
1. 登录到PostgreSQL服务器
首先,确保你有权限登录到PostgreSQL服务器。你可以使用psql
命令行工具来登录。
sudo -u postgres psql
2. 找到postgresql.conf
文件
postgresql.conf
文件通常位于PostgreSQL数据目录中。你可以通过以下命令找到它:
sudo find / -name postgresql.conf
常见的位置可能是:
/etc/postgresql/< version> /main/postgresql.conf
/var/lib/postgresql/< version> /main/postgresql.conf
3. 编辑postgresql.conf
文件
使用你喜欢的文本编辑器(如nano
、vim
)打开postgresql.conf
文件。
sudo nano /etc/postgresql/<
version>
/main/postgresql.conf
4. 修改参数
在postgresql.conf
文件中找到你想要修改的参数,并根据需要进行调整。例如,如果你想修改shared_buffers
参数:
# 共享内存缓冲区大小
shared_buffers = 25% of total RAM
你可以将其修改为具体的数值,例如:
shared_buffers = 4GB
5. 保存并退出编辑器
保存对postgresql.conf
文件的更改并退出编辑器。
6. 重启PostgreSQL服务
为了使更改生效,你需要重启PostgreSQL服务。
sudo systemctl restart postgresql
或者,如果你使用的是旧版本的Debian系统,可以使用以下命令:
sudo service postgresql restart
7. 验证更改
重启服务后,你可以使用psql
命令行工具连接到PostgreSQL服务器,并查看参数是否已正确应用。
sudo -u postgres psql
在psql
提示符下,运行以下命令查看参数:
SHOW shared_buffers;
你应该能看到你刚刚设置的值。
注意事项
- 在修改参数之前,确保你了解每个参数的作用和影响。
- 一些参数可能需要重启数据库集群才能生效。
- 如果你不确定某个参数的默认值或推荐值,可以参考PostgreSQL官方文档。
通过以上步骤,你可以在Debian系统上成功自定义PostgreSQL参数。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: Debian如何自定义PostgreSQL参数
本文地址: https://pptw.com/jishu/724872.html